feat: 新增告警导出接口

This commit is contained in:
TsMask
2025-04-18 19:19:06 +08:00
parent 52642e5c6b
commit 6bed1fda33
5 changed files with 178 additions and 4 deletions

View File

@@ -46,12 +46,19 @@ func Setup(router *gin.Engine) {
)
alarmGroup.PUT("/clear",
middleware.PreAuthorize(nil),
collectlogs.OperateLog(collectlogs.OptionNew("log.operate.title.alarm", collectlogs.BUSINESS_TYPE_UPDATE)),
controller.NewAlarm.Clear,
)
alarmGroup.PUT("/ack",
middleware.PreAuthorize(nil),
collectlogs.OperateLog(collectlogs.OptionNew("log.operate.title.alarm", collectlogs.BUSINESS_TYPE_UPDATE)),
controller.NewAlarm.Ack,
)
alarmGroup.GET("/export",
middleware.PreAuthorize(nil),
collectlogs.OperateLog(collectlogs.OptionNew("log.operate.title.alarm", collectlogs.BUSINESS_TYPE_EXPORT)),
controller.NewAlarm.Export,
)
}
// 告警日志数据信息